工具介绍
华为云CodeArts由华为公司开发,依托其30年研发实践和技术积累,为企业提供一站式软件开发生命周期管理工具,解决研发流程碎片化、效率低下等问题。
平台核心技术创新包括云原生微服务架构、分布式存储和多维安全防护,并集成AI能力如代码智能检查、测试用例自动生成,实现构建速度提升50%以上。
主要面向软件开发团队、IT部门和企业用户,包括金融、电商和制造业,适用于跨地域协同开发、合规要求高的应用场景,是企业数字化转型的关键工具链。
核心功能
需求管理
支持敏捷看板和甘特图,实现需求-任务-代码的多维关联,内置IPD、DevSecOps等行业模板。
代码托管
提供企业级Git服务,支持百万级代码库管理、多仓库协同和代码智能检索,保障细粒度权限控制。
流水线
可视化编排构建部署流程,支持多环境贯通和分布式缓存技术,构建速度提升50%。
代码检查
执行静态、安全和架构等多维度检查,AI辅助坏味道检测,增量分析减少冗余。
测试管理
覆盖用例设计到缺陷跟踪,支持自动化测试和AI生成边界用例,提升覆盖率。
制品仓库
管理构建产物,支持10+仓库类型如Maven和npm,提供聚合仓和开源合规扫描。
界面截图
华为云CodeArts
适用场景
1
金融合规开发
实现需求与监管要求追溯、自动化安全扫描和全程审计日志,缩短开发周期30%。
2
敏捷交付
提高构建部署频率至每日多次,减少故障恢复时间至分钟级,适用于电商等互联网业务。
3
大型协同研发
支持跨地域数千研发人员统一工具链和知识沉淀,降低培训成本并提升协作效率。
4
智能测试
自动生成测试用例并分析日志异常,减少手动测试工作量,提升产品质量。
优缺点分析
👍 优点
- 全流程覆盖需求规划到部署运维,消除工具链割裂问题,提升端到端研发效率。
- 内置华为3000+代码检查规则和最佳实践模板,开箱即用,降低实施门槛。
- 通过ISO 27001和等保2.0认证,提供四层安全防护,保障企业数据可靠性和合规性。
- AI能力深度集成,实现代码自动补全和缺陷预测,加速智能开发流程。
- 云原生架构支持多AZ容灾,保障99.95%可用性,性能较开源工具提升5-10倍。
👎 缺点
竞品对比
| 产品 | 全流程覆盖评级 | 本地化服务评级 | 安全合规评级 | 华为生态集成评级 | AI能力评级 |
|---|---|---|---|---|---|
| 华为云CodeArts | ★★★★★ | ★★★★★ | ✗ | ✗ | ✗ |
| 主流竞品A | ★★★☆ | ★★☆ | ✗ | ✗ | ✗ |
| 主流竞品B | ★★★★ | ★★★☆ | ✗ | ✗ | ✗ |